Utilities offered include XSLT stylesheets (XSLT 3.0 for performance/power or XSLT 1.0 to run in a browser); CSS stylesheets; XProc pipelines and (a little) XQuery. Nothing here is authoritative as models are still evolving.
At present, contains CSS applicable to OSCAL in an authoring environment (such as an XML editor supporting CSS styling)
XSLT transformations for converting XML OSCAL into JSON OSCAL and vice versa. These transformations are machine-written from metaschema inputs. See ../schema/metaschema for the metaschema inputs and ../build/metaschema for the mechanics.
Various and miscellaneous utilities, in various stages of documentation and polish.
Transformations (stylesheets) for converting OSCAL catalogs or (resolved) profiles into published outputs such as HTML and markdown.
An XSLT transformation that provides for resolution of OSCAL profiles into catalog-like XML documents. Under development.